Abstract
A layer of the peritoneum which attaches the abdominal viscera to the ABDOMINAL WALL and conveys their blood vessels and nerves.

Indexing Annotation
avoid /blood supply: prefer MESENTERIC ARTERIES or MESENTERIC VEINS; for mesenteric circulation use SPLANCHNIC CIRCULATION; diseases: coordinate with PERITONEAL DISEASES; neoplasms: coordinate with PERITONEAL NEOPLASMS
